Who You Need on Your Team

A strong assisted living team includes a mix of administrative and caregiving staff. Here are the essential roles:

๐Ÿ‘จ‍๐Ÿ’ผ Administrator – The leader who manages daily operations, staffing, and compliance. You can take this role yourself or hire someone experienced.
๐Ÿ“‹ Assistant Administrator/House Manager – Helps with scheduling, hiring, and handling supplies. Not required, but very useful!
๐Ÿ’Š Medication Technician (Med Tech/QMAP) – Certified to pass medications under a nurse’s supervision. This helps reduce caregiver workload and ensures meds are given correctly.
โค๏ธ Caregivers – Provide daily assistance like bathing, dressing, and toileting. Some states require Certified Nursing Assistants (CNAs), so check your local rules.
๐Ÿฉบ Nurse (RN or LPN/LVN) – Oversees medical care, does resident assessments, and updates care plans. For small homes, a part-time nurse is usually enough.
๐Ÿงน Housekeeper – Keeps the facility clean and helps with laundry. Not required, but very helpful!
๐Ÿ”ง Handyman – Can be hired as needed to handle repairs and maintenance.

๐Ÿ“Œ Pro Tip: Check your state laws! Some states require specific staff-to-resident ratios or certifications.


Where to Find Great Staff

Hiring the right team starts with knowing where to look. Here are some top places to find quality candidates:

โœ” Indeed – Best for hiring administrators, caregivers, and med techs.
โœ” Facebook Groups & Marketplace – Great for finding local caregivers and CNAs.
โœ” LinkedIn – Ideal for hiring administrators and RNs.
โœ” Community Colleges & Training Programs – A great source for newly certified caregivers and med techs.

๐Ÿ“Œ Pro Tip: Assisted living has a high turnover rate. Keep a steady pipeline of candidates so you’re never short-staffed!


How to Hire the Right People

Follow these five simple steps to build a winning team:

1๏ธโƒฃ Create a Clear Job Description

Outline job responsibilities, experience needed, and pay range. The more detailed, the better!

2๏ธโƒฃ Review Resumes & Applications

Look for candidates with relevant experience, good references, and proper certifications.

3๏ธโƒฃ Conduct Interviews

Ask about their experience, personality, and how they handle caregiving challenges. Look for kindness, patience, and reliability.

4๏ธโƒฃ Check References

Call previous employers to verify work ethic, reliability, and performance.

5๏ธโƒฃ Make an Offer & Onboard

Once you find the right fit, extend a job offer and start training.

๐Ÿ“Œ Pro Tip: Be upfront about pay raises, promotions, and notice periods for quitting. This prevents surprises later!


Onboarding & Training Tips

Once you’ve hired your team, set them up for success with a strong onboarding process:

๐Ÿ“‘ Complete Paperwork – I-9, W-4, background checks, and any state-required documents.
๐Ÿ“š Provide Training – Make sure staff complete all required certifications and state training.
๐Ÿ“ Set Clear Expectations – Explain facility rules, work schedules, and performance expectations.
๐Ÿ’ฐ Set Up Payroll – Use a service like Gusto to handle payroll, direct deposits, and tax deductions.

๐Ÿ“Œ Pro Tip: Happy employees stay longer! Offer good pay, fair schedules, and a positive work environment to reduce turnover.
